Apply to be a Choral Scholar


Applications are now open for Choral Scholarships in the 2026/27 season.

The Choral Scholar role is to enhance and support the choir. Choral Scholars will be able to develop their abilities through performance with the choir and solo performances (by agreement with the Music Director).


During their appointment, Choral Scholars receive:

 An honorarium of £300 per term (total £900 for a season) plus extra fees for solos and events 

 Opportunities for solo performances at St Cecilia Chorus concerts which are accompanied by professional musicians or orchestra

 Support for their music studies, singing technique and solo performances from our Music Director Ed Walters and accompanist Ian le Grice

 Two complimentary adult tickets for each St Cecilia Chorus concert during their tenure


Responsibilities of Choral Scholars:

 Attend the weekly choir rehearsals regularly (Term times on Thursdays 19:45-21.45 at Banstead Community Junior School, SM7 2BQ)

 Perform at all St Cecilia Chorus concerts during the period of the agreement

 Undertake independent work outside rehearsals if necessary to ensure quality of performance

 Provide an approved deputy if unable to sing at a concert

 Attend a probation meeting after one month of their appointment with the Music Director and Chair of St Cecilia Chorus.

 It is also desirable that the Choral Scholars take part in some wider aspects of St Cecilia Chorus’ activities e.g. a workshop, promotional event etc
